Drain Cleaning in Lathrop, California

Lathrop's Mediterranean climate creates unique challenges for residential and commercial drainage systems. Hot, dry summers cause clay soil to contract and shift, while winter rains saturate the ground, leading to pipe movement and separation. These conditions, combined with aging infrastructure in many neighborhoods, make routine drain maintenance essential for preventing costly backups and property damage.

Tree root intrusion represents one of the most common drain problems in Lathrop. The area's mature Valley Oak and Cottonwood trees aggressively seek moisture in sewer lines, especially in older clay pipe systems. Additionally, hard water mineral buildup from Central Valley groundwater gradually narrows pipe diameter, reducing flow capacity and increasing clog frequency in homes throughout the community.

About Drain Cleaning in Lathrop

Lathrop homeowners face specific drainage challenges due to the region's distinctive soil composition and climate patterns. The clay-rich soils prevalent in San Joaquin County expand dramatically during winter rainfall, exerting pressure on underground pipes and creating cracks where tree roots invade. During summer months, soil contraction leaves pipes unsupported, increasing the risk of bellies and offsets that trap debris. Local neighborhoods built before 1990 often contain Orangeburg or clay tile sewer lines particularly vulnerable to these ground movement cycles.

The agricultural heritage of Lathrop means many properties feature mature landscaping with water-seeking trees like Modesto Ash, Chinese Pistache, and various fruit trees planted decades ago. These species develop extensive root systems that penetrate even small pipe joints, causing recurring blockages.
